10 Steps to Cutting Cancer Risk

A recent survey of over 1000 women revealed that Australian women are putting their lives at risk by not taking the necessary precaucations against women's cancers.

To combat this low awareness, the Cancer Council has developed these 10 simple steps to help women reduce their risk of developing women's cancer as well as ensuring that any problems are detected earlier:

Exercise regularly and keep your weight in a normal range.
Eat a health diet with at least five servings of vegetables and two servings of fruit each day.
Don't smoke, and if you do, quit.
Limit or avoid drinking alcohol and have some alcohol free days.
Have pap test every two years if you are between the ages of 18-69.
Be breast aware - see your doctor promptly if you find a lump in your breast, dimpling of the skin or changes in the nipple.
Have a mammogram every two years if you are between the ages of 50-69
Don't ignore changes in your body, such as swelling, bloating, sudden weight gain or loss, or changes in your normal menstrual pattern.
Know your family's cancer history and seek advice from your doctor or the Cancer Council Helpline (1311 20) if you have concerns.
Every woman's body is different and only you know what's normal for you. If you notice something that is unusal for you, see your doctor.
Remember - One of the best defences women have against cancer is increasing awareness of their own bodies!

If you would like any further information about women's cancers, please visit www.girlsnightin.com.au or call the Cancer Council Helpline on 13 11 20.
